How do you change the mode on a Nordic hot tub?

Mode is changed by pressing “Warm” or “Cool” then “Light”. Some tubs will have the modes disabled from the factory. Standard Mode maintains set temperature. St will be displayed momentarily when you switch into Standard Mode.

What should the temperature be in the Arctic spa?

The other thing to keep in mind is that the Arctic Spa’s really designed to run at 100 degrees or above. So if you’re trying to run it down into the 90 degree range, the Arctic Spa just is simply not designed to be able to maintain that temperature, especially when it’s 100 degrees outside, or something like that.

Why is my Arctic Spa hot tub overheating?

So the first thing to remember is that the Arctic Spa is designed to utilize the excess heat from the motors to heat the water. So as we go through that filtration cycle, that motor is going to be running and it’s gonna be generating heat.

Why does my hot tub keep running at 108f?

If the display says 108F and the water is actually that temp. and the “heat on” symbol/light shut off on the display at the set temp. of 100F…. Then you have a circuit board that is continuing to power the heater after it supposed to shut off. That would mean a bad board.
